Our Four-Step Retaining Wall Process

Our straightforward four-step process delivers long-lasting retaining walls, sidewalks, custom patios, and driveways across the Sandhills and near Fort Bragg. We conduct an initial project review before providing your detailed estimate, utilizing premium fiber concrete mixes for maximum durability. Explore our process below, and contact Three Generations Concrete today with any questions.

01

Initial Site Review

We evaluate your property's topography, soil conditions, and grading needs on-site to accurately scope your retaining wall, sidewalk, or flatwork project before drafting an estimate.

02

Review-Based Estimate

Following our initial evaluation, we provide a transparent digital proposal detailing our high-grade fiber concrete mixes, integrated drainage plans, and clear construction timelines.

03

Fiber Concrete Construction

Our experienced crew prepares a stable base, installs backfill drainage, and pours high-quality concrete mixes infused with structural fibers for unmatched durability and performance.

04

Final Quality Walkthrough

We conduct a thorough on-site inspection with you to review the finished work, clean up all debris, and ensure total satisfaction with your investment.

Yes, built-in drainage is critical to alleviate hydrostatic pressure behind walls. During our initial project review, we design tailored gravel backfill and drainage systems that seamlessly protect adjacent sidewalks and landscapes from heavy Sandhills rainfall.
